Singapore Management University

The Singapore Management University (SMU) holds the unique position of being Singapore's first private university funded by the government of Singapore. An Act of Parliament empowers SMU to confer its own degrees recognised by the government. This flexibility will facilitate SMU's aim to be a world-class university on par with the best internationally. With English as the working language in Singapore and at SMU, international students and faculty find it particularly accessible studying and working here.

The SMU approach to preparing graduates for an era of unparalleled choices is a focused but broad-based education. Modeled after the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ania, America's top business school, SMU's curriculum aims to groom outstanding business leaders and creative entrepreneurs capable of excelling in a rapidly changing and dynamic world.

SMU currently offers :

Bachelor of Accountancy
Bachelor of Business Management
Bachelor of Science (Economics)
Bachelor of Science (Information Systems Management)

All these programmes are conducted on a full-time basis only. There are no part-time undergraduate programmes.SMU recognises that applicants may show talent and outstanding achievements in areas other than academic studies. SMU seeks students with strong academic potential, high self-motivation and broad interests. We aim to enroll individuals who will contribute to a rich university learning environment and benefit most from a stimulating and vibrant campus experience.

Admission will be competitive and selective to allow students outstanding in different fields to be considered on their own merit. SMU will use several measures to evaluate an applicant's achievements and abilities. Besides their academic results and SAT I scores, a personal essay and an interview will also count.

SMU welcomes students from all streams (science, arts, commerce, engineering, etc.). At SMU they enjoy the best of both worlds - a top-class US curriculum and teaching method (in collaboration with the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ania) and the convenience and affordability of the local setting. In addition, there are opportunities for overseas exchange programmes.

The tuition fees at SMU are comparable to the fees charged at the other universities in Singapore. Scholarships and financial assistance schemes are available to deserving students. Students who do well in their studies at SMU will be eligible for the various Student Awards.

Double Degree Programme

Under the double degree programme, a student can graduate in four years with two degrees - in any combination in Accountancy, Business Management, Economics or Information Systems Management.

The double degree programme gives students an invaluable edge in the New Economy, and an unrivalled versatility and flexibility in career options.

Students who have outstanding results in their GCE A-Levels or polytechnic or equivalent high school qualifications, may apply for direct entry into the double degree programme.

Alternatively, SMU students who are enrolled in a single degree programme and have excellent results in their first year at SMU, will also have the opportunity to opt for the double degree programme.

Second Major Programme

All SMU students enrolled in a single degree programme and have done well in their first year at SMU may opt to do a second major in any of the following:

  • Accounting
  • Economics
  • Finance
  • Information Systems Management
  • Law
  • Marketing

Students may opt for a second major at the end of their first year at SMU, not at the point of application for admission to SMU.

Bachelor of Science (Economics)

The Bachelor of Science (Economics) is a 4-year programme modeled after the best of America's undergraduate economics programmes. Students will be given a broad-based liberal education, flexibility in the choice of certain subjects, yet at the same time major in Economics. The curriculum is similar in structure to the two other degree programmes offered by SMU (the BBM and the BAcc) both of which have been developed in close collaboration with the consistently top ranked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ania.

Each student is required to complete 35 courses from all the subject areas. Each subject area has a list of courses whereby each student chooses his/her courses according to his/her preferred interests and pace. Each student must read a minimum of 3 courses and a maximum of 6 courses per term.

Bachelor of Accountancy

The Bachelor of Accountancy (BAcc) is a 4-year programme to develop well-rounded individuals schooled in a variety of subject areas. Modelled after the best of America's top business schools, the curriculum has been developed in close collaboration with the consistently top ranked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ania.

The BAcc programme aims to produce professional accountants who possess the attributes and skills that are needed to thrive in a knowledge-based economy. Such attributes include analytical and creative abilities, a broad perspective to think across disciplines and geographical or political boundaries, and a confident mastery of today's technology.

The BAcc curriculum is designed to fulfil all professional requirements for recognition by the accountancy profession without the need for further examinations, other than the pre-admission course required for all new members of the Institute of Certified Public Accountants of Singapore (ICPAS). At the same time, it offers a broad-based and liberal education so as to provide the student with a broader perspective of the work environment and the world at large.

A distinctive feature of the BAcc programme is that top accounting professionals from the accounting profession and industry will participate in the programme as adjunct professors. Audit and tax partners and senior managers from the Big 5 accounting firms will bring real life perspective into the classrooms as instructors for audit and taxation courses. Besides giving students first-hand knowledge, these partners and senior managers will also select students from their classes to go on business internships at their firms. These internships last for a minimum of 10 weeks and can begin anytime after the completion of the first year of studies. Many students can expect to receive employment at these firms by the time they complete their accountancy programme.

Each student is required to complete 35 courses. Each subject area has a list of courses which must all be completed unless a choice is indicated. Students must read a minimum of 3 courses and a maximum of 6 courses per term.
